Top Credit Cards from Bank of America

By Credit Card KarmaJan 26, 2019, 21:39 pm

0

Bank of America Credit Cards

For every Bank of America customer, having cash rewards credit card or travel rewards credit card is a must as it will give you many loyalty points that will benefit you at different points. However, even if you are not a regular customer at Bank of America or don’t have an account in the bank then also you can apply for one of the credit cards offered by the bank and get amazing benefits.

Here are some of the best credit cards that are offered by Bank of America and you can choose among them, depending on your requirements.

Bank of America Cash Rewards Credit Card

  • Annual Fee: $0
  • Intro Bonus: $150
  • Intro Purchase APR: 0% for 12 billing cycles
  • Regular APR: 16.24% – 26.24% Variable
  • Intro Balance Transfers APR: 0% for 12 billing cycles

The reward rates of Bank of America Cash Rewards are:

  • You will get 3% cash back in the category of your choice (up to $2,500 in combined choice category/wholesale club quarterly purchase/grocery store)
  • You will get 2% at wholesale clubs and grocery stores (up to $2,500 in combined choice category/wholesale club quarterly purchase/grocery store)
  • You will get 1% unlimited return on all the other purchases

Some of the quick highlights of Bank of America Cash Rewards are:

  • You will get $150 cash as sign up bonus if you will spend $500 within first 90 days of opening the account
  • You can maximize the cash back in any of the categories of your choice – online shopping, drug stores, gas, furnishing/home improvements, travel and dining
  • You can update the choice calendar for all the future purchases at the end of each month using the online banking or mobile banking app, or you can just let it be as it is
  • There is no expiry period for rewards
  • If you are a Preferred Rewards client, then you will be eligible to get 25%-75% rewards bonus on every purchase

Bank of America Travel Rewards Credit Card

  • Annual Fee: $0
  • Intro Bonus: 25,000 Points
  • Intro Purchase APR: 0% for 12 billing cycles
  • Regular APR: 17.24% – 25.24% Variable
  • Intro Balance Transfers APR: N/A

The rewards rates of Bank of America Travel Rewards are:

  • You can earn 1.5 points for every dollar you will spend on all the purchases
  • There is no absolutely limit to the maximum number of points that you can earn

Some of the quick highlights of Bank of America Travel Rewards are:

  • The reward points never expire
  • These bonus points could be used as $250 statement credits for the travel purchases
  • You can use your card on any of the online websites without any restrictions to book your trips to any destination at any time
  • You can redeem your points for a statement credit in order to pay for vacation packages, hotels, flights, baggage fee, rental cars or cruises
  • The card comes with a chip technology in order to provide enhanced security at chip-enabled terminals
  • You will get an additional 10% customer points as bonus on each purchase if you have an active savings or checking Bank of America account
  • If you are Preferred Rewards client, then you can get an increased bonus of 25% to 75%

Bank of America Premium Rewards Credit Card

  • Annual Fee: $95
  • Intro Bonus: 50,000 Points
  • Intro Purchase APR: N/A
  • Regular APR: 18.24% – 25.24% Variable
  • Intro Balance Transfers APR: N/A

The reward rates of Bank of America Premium Rewards are:

  • You will get 2 points for every dollar spent on travel and dining expenses
  • You will get 1.5 points for every dollar spent on all the other purchases

Some of the quick highlights of Bank of America Premium Rewards are:

  • You will get 50,000 sign up bonus points which are equivalent to $500 if you will make the purchases of $3,000 within the first 90 days from opening up of the account
  • There is no maximum limit to the number of points that you can earn, thus you can have unlimited points for your purchases throughout the year
  • There is a very low annual fee of $95
  • You can redeem the reward points for cash back as statement credits, purchase a gift card, deposit into an eligible Bank of America account, make purchases at Bank of America Travel Center or credit to eligible Merrill Lynch and Merrill Edge accounts
  • There is no foreign transaction fee
  • If you are a Preferred Rewards client of Bank of America, you will be eligible to earn 25% to 75% as bonus on all your purchases

AAA Credit Card

  • Annual Fee: $0
  • Intro Bonus: $150
  • Regular APR: 15.49% – 25.49% Variable
  • Intro Balance Transfers APR: 0% for 12 billing cycles

The reward rates of AAA Credit Cards are:

  • You will get a bonus of $150 statement credit after an expenditure of $500 within first 90 days of account opening
  • You will earn 3 points on every dollar spent on travel and purchases made at AAA
  • You will earn 2 points on every dollar spent at grocery stores, medical stores, and wholesale club
  • You will earn 2 points on every dollar spent for all other purchases

Some of the quick highlights of AAA Credit Card are:

  • There is no annual fee and the card offers the most impressive cash back on travel, groceries, and gas
  • It is comparatively easy to qualify for the card so that more and number of prospective cardholders can enjoy the innumerable benefits the card offers
  • It proves to be a perfect choice for frequent travelers because there is no foreign transaction fee

 

Bank of America (BofA) Credit Card Login

In order to log into your Bank of America credit card online account, navigate to the Bank Of America credit card homepage https://www.bankofamerica.com/credit-cards/manage-your-credit-card-account/ and supply your User ID and Password in the empty spaces. You can save your login credentials for future logins by clicking the box next to Remember Me. Lastly, click login to gain entry to your online account
